    History

    The Godavari River has deep historical and mythological roots. It is mentioned in several ancient scriptures and is considered one of the holiest rivers in Hinduism. The river has witnessed the rise and fall of many kingdoms and empires, and its banks have been home to numerous sages and saints. It has played a crucial role in the economic and cultural development of the region. The river's significance is evident in the numerous temples and ghats that dot its course, each with its own unique story and historical importance. The river continues to be a lifeline for the people of East Godavari.
